The Ferrowgate fee engine evaluates shipping rules in priority order and short-circuits on first match. On-call should know that rule evaluation is bounded by a hard timeout, after which the fallback flat rate applies and an alert fires. Misconfigured bounds are the most common page source. The engine's current production tuning constants are the following.

constants for fajop-tahaf:
RATE_LIMITS = {
    "holael": 2,
    "oliael": 10,
    "druael": 10,
    "wenwyn": 10,
}

## Tuning

The Larkspur build migrated to the hermetic Quenchpack toolchain in Q3. Reviewers should verify that no targets still shell out to host binaries; hermeticity checks fail the build otherwise. Cache hit rates dropped after migration, so sandbox and fetch parallelism were retuned against the Bramleyford CI fleet. Most defaults are fine, but remote-exec timeouts needed widening. The constants below govern sandbox sizing and remote cache behavior.

tuning constants:
RATE_LIMITS = {
    "wenwyn": 1,
    "zorix": 10,
    "oliix": 2,
    "holael": 10,
}

Subject: On-call handoff — relevance tuning notes

Hi Dara,

Welcome to the Quillseek on-call rotation! Since you're also wearing the security-review hat, please skim the relevance tuning notes before touching boost weights — some signals pull from the profile enrichment pipeline, which has access controls you'll want to verify. Nothing scary, just be careful with the synonym dictionary imports. Everything lives on the internal wiki page.

dashboard of bafof-hafog = https://confluence.lumiclabs.internal/display/browse/display/6a09a20a

## Ownership

The telemetry compression layer in Pondwire encodes payloads with a dictionary-trained zstd pass before they reach the uplink queue. Reviewers should note that dictionary regeneration is gated behind the `compaction-window` flag and must never run during peak ingest, as partial dictionaries corrupt downstream decoders. Any change to frame headers requires a migration note in `docs/wire-format.md`. Questions about compression ratios, dictionary rotation, or decoder compatibility go to the module owner.

account owner for kafop-haweg: Pelax Gilael Istir